A Comprehensive Guide to Casement Window Replacement

Casement windows are a popular choice among homeowners due to their distinct performance and aesthetic appeal. Why Replace Casement Windows?

Before diving into the replacement process, it's crucial to comprehend why house owners may choose to change casement windows:

  • Energy Efficiency: Older windows may have lost their insulation residential or commercial properties, leading to increased energy expenses.
  • Aesthetic Updates: Homeowners may wish to enhance the outside look of their homes.
  • Performance Issues: Worn-out or damaged windows might be challenging to open or seal properly.
  • Sound Reduction: Newer designs typically provide much better sound insulation, enhancing indoor comfort.

When to Replace Casement Windows

Identifying the right time for a casement window replacement is vital. Here are some indications that show a need for replacement:

  1. Visible Damage: Look for fractures, chips, or warping in the window frame.
  2. Drafts: Noticeable drafts when the windows are closed signal that the seals may be compromised.
  3. Condensation: Presence of water in between the panes shows failed double glazing.
  4. Difficulty in Operation: If windows end up being difficult to open or close, it may be time for replacements.

Selecting the Right Casement Windows

When selecting new casement windows, think about the following factors:

Material:

  • Vinyl: Low maintenance, great insulation.
  • Wood: Classic look however requires more upkeep.
  • Aluminum: Durable however may not be as energy-efficient.
  • Energy Efficiency Ratings: Look for Energy Star-certified windows to ensure lower energy expenses.
  • Design and Customization: Choose a design that complements your home's architecture, with options for color, size, and grid patterns.

Table 1: Comparison of Window Materials

MaterialProsCons
VinylLow upkeep, energy-efficientMinimal color options
WoodAesthetic appeal, insulationHigh upkeep, susceptible to rot
AluminumToughness, lightweightPoor insulation

The Window Replacement Process

Replacing casement windows can be a sizable task. Here's a step-by-step guide to assist house owners:

Step 1: Measure the Opening

Precise measurements are vital. Utilize a measuring tape to identify the width and height of the window opening. Step at multiple indicate ensure harmony, as old frames may not be completely square.

Step 2: Remove the Old Window

  1. Prepare the Area: Clear the surrounding space of furniture or designs.
  2. Eliminate Window Stops: Gently pry off the stops holding the window in place.
  3. Get the Old Window: Remove the window frame carefully, guaranteeing not to harm the surrounding wall or trim.

Step 3: Install New Windows

  1. Inspect the Opening: Clean and prepare the opening for the brand-new window.
  2. Insert the New Window: Center the brand-new casement window in the opening, ensuring it is level.
  3. Secure the Window: Fasten it according to the maker's instructions, generally with screws.
  4. Seal the Edges: Use caulk to seal the edges and prevent air and water leaks.

Step 4: Finishing Touches

  1. Reattach Stops: Replace the window stops to secure the window in place.
  2. Retouch Paint: If necessary, paint or finish the trim around the window to match the decoration.

Step 5: Clean Up

Get rid of any debris from the installation procedure and check for any problems. Ensure that the window opens and closes efficiently.

FAQs about Casement Window Replacement

What is the typical cost of casement window replacement?

The cost might vary widely based on window type, materials, and labor. Typically, property owners can anticipate to spend in between ₤ 300 to ₤ 800 per window, including installation.

How long does it take to replace casement windows?

The replacement procedure for a single window typically takes between 2 to 4 hours, while numerous windows might require an entire day or more, depending upon the degree of work required.

Can I replace casement windows myself?

While DIY replacement is possible, it requires exact measurements, tools, and skills. Hiring a professional may guarantee a greater quality of installation.

What maintenance is needed after installation?

New casement windows require very little maintenance. Routine cleaning of the glass and lubrication of the hinges will guarantee lasting efficiency. Inspect seals occasionally and clean window tracks.

Are casement windows a good choice for energy efficiency?

Yes, casement windows are understood for their energy effectiveness, specifically when correctly sealed and set up. They provide excellent ventilation without sacrificing thermal efficiency.
